They are home to about 2 billion people globally and provide half of the world’s livestock and 44 percent of the world’s cultivated systems.\n\nFound on every continent, drylands are under severe pressure from human activities and climate change, with 25–35% now considered as degraded. These damaged lands suffer from reduced agricultural productivity, food and nutrition insecurity, limited economic development, inadequate water management, declining resilience to climate variability, social and political instability, and human migration.\n\nTo reverse this worsening crisis, CIFOR-ICRAF have developed a range of innovative solutions that help farmers and counter the effects of severe degradation.","link_original":"https://www.cifor-icraf.org/restoration-for-resilience/dryland/?utm_source=site-search&utm_medium=cifor-icraf-website&utm_campaign=traffic-source","status":2,"country":[],"sections":[{"id":46,"name":"Drylands"}],"root_section":{"id":108,"name":"Conserving Wild Nature"},"is_photo":false,"is_video":false,"is_large_font":false,"show_in_news_list":false,"url_to_show_in_news_list":"","location_filters":{"countries":[],"regions":[]},"filters":[]},{"id":"f7e2ce33-3f86-47bd-a7d3-c44394f5bc71","slug":"what-is-green-hydrogen-and-will-it-power-the-future-cnbc-post","created_at":"2025-04-11T10:08:40.849014Z","views":49,"name":"What Is Green Hydrogen And Will It Power The Future? | CNBC","about":"Hydrogen produced from renewable electricity, known as green hydrogen, could be the solution to cutting our carbon footprint. Several pollutants already included will now be subject to tighter environmental quality standards.\n\nThe new measures also put a stronger focus on substances of emerging concern, such as microplastics and antimicrobial resistance indicators.\n\nEU countries will have until 21 December 2027 to make their national rules comply with the provisions of this directive.","link_original":"https://www.europarl.europa.eu/news/en/press-room/20260323IPR38828/parliament-adopts-more-stringent-rules-to-reduce-water-pollution","status":2,"country":[],"sections":[{"id":204,"name":"Total environmental pollution"}],"root_section":{"id":107,"name":"Life-friendly Earth"},"is_photo":false,"is_video":false,"is_large_font":false,"show_in_news_list":false,"url_to_show_in_news_list":"","location_filters":{"countries":[],"regions":[{"id":3,"name":"Europe"}]},"filters":[{"id":4,"name":"Websites","badge_name":"Website","show_badge":true,"children":[{"id":6,"name":"Regulations","badge_name":"Regulation","show_badge":false,"children":[]}],"all_children":false,"all_children_ids":"5,6,7"}]},{"id":"f7f78cb3-e738-4b0b-a1cb-0a09eada1dc5","slug":"the-eu-sets-out-its-international-digital-strategy-post","created_at":"2025-06-06T14:19:23.130728Z","views":26,"name":"The EU sets out its International Digital Strategy","about":"The European Commission and the High Representative set out a joint vision for the EU's external action for digital.","text":"As the digital revolution is reshaping economies and societies in a global geopolitical landscape which is more challenging than ever, the new EU International Digital Strategy shows that the EU is a stable and reliable partner, open to digital cooperation with allies and partners.\n\nWhile the EU will spare no effort to boost competitiveness in AI and other key technologies at home, it will also work with partners to support their own digital transition. It boasts 1,500 endemic plant species and 53 endemic species of mammals, birds, reptiles, amphibians, and freshwater fish found exclusively in this region. The report emphasizes the importance of considering the political and cultural aspects alongside the ecological value when addressing conservation in this hotspot.\n\nProviding insights into the geography, climate, biological history, species diversity, and threat status, the report discusses ecosystem services and identifies conservation goals at the global, landscape, and species levels. Additionally, it examines the socioeconomic factors influencing conservation outcomes and evaluates relevant policies and agreements at local, regional, and international levels.","link_original":"https://www.cepf.net/sites/default/files/mountains-central-asia-ecosystem-profile-eng.pdf","status":2,"country":[{"id":1,"name":"Afghanistan","icon":""},{"id":49,"name":"China","icon":""},{"id":118,"name":"Kazakhstan","icon":""},{"id":122,"name":"Kyrgyzstan","icon":""},{"id":223,"name":"Tajikistan","icon":""},{"id":233,"name":"Turkmenistan","icon":""},{"id":242,"name":"Uzbekistan","icon":""}],"sections":[{"id":47,"name":"Mountains"}],"root_section":{"id":108,"name":"Conserving Wild Nature"},"is_photo":false,"is_video":false,"is_large_font":false,"show_in_news_list":false,"url_to_show_in_news_list":"","location_filters":{"countries":[{"id":1,"name":"Afghanistan"},{"id":49,"name":"China"},{"id":118,"name":"Kazakhstan"},{"id":122,"name":"Kyrgyzstan"},{"id":223,"name":"Tajikistan"},{"id":233,"name":"Turkmenistan"},{"id":242,"name":"Uzbekistan"}],"regions":[]},"filters":[{"id":8,"name":"Enlightenment","badge_name":"Enlightenment","show_badge":false,"children":[{"id":10,"name":"Books","badge_name":"Book","show_badge":false,"children":[]}],"all_children":false,"all_children_ids":"9,10,27,11,12"}]},{"id":"f80acc0a-06a4-44ff-a91c-80a4b93e51a1","slug":"world-of-the-wild-episode-2-africas-savannah-a-2024-documentary-by-free-documentary-nature-post","created_at":"2025-04-28T11:34:29.715252Z","views":23,"name":"World of the Wild | Episode 2: Africa's Savannah, a 2024 documentary by Free Documentary - Nature","about":"African grasslands support vast and diverse wildlife. As cross-border supply chains grow, challenges in sustainability, efficiency, and resilience increase, requiring a whole-of-chain approach to trade and supply chain management. Resilient supply chains are vital for economic stability amid risks like extreme weather, geopolitical tensions, cyber threats, and regulatory uncertainty. OECD analysis shows that reshoring or reducing trade ties does not necessarily improve resilience. Instead, resilience depends on agile, adaptable systems that help firms and governments respond to shocks while keeping trade flowing. The OECD Supply Chain Resilience Review highlights that smarter policies - trade facilitation, improved services, digital readiness, and stronger international cooperation - strengthen supply chains more effectively than isolation.","link_original":"https://www.oecd.org/en/topics/global-value-and-supply-chains.html","status":2,"country":[],"sections":[{"id":64,"name":"New integrated value chains"}],"root_section":{"id":51,"name":"Industrial Revolution"},"is_photo":true,"is_video":false,"is_large_font":false,"show_in_news_list":false,"url_to_show_in_news_list":"","location_filters":{"countries":[],"regions":[{"id":12,"name":"Global"}]},"filters":[{"id":8,"name":"Enlightenment","badge_name":"Enlightenment","show_badge":false,"children":[{"id":27,"name":"Publications","badge_name":"Publication","show_badge":false,"children":[]}],"all_children":false,"all_children_ids":"9,10,27,11,12"}]},{"id":"f87ead9a-c9db-4d3e-a597-bb0940f7486b","slug":"spacecom-the-global-commercial-space-conference-exposition-january-30-february-1-2024-orlando-usa-post","created_at":"2024-01-30T12:58:04Z","views":39,"name":"SpaceCom, The Global Commercial Space Conference & Exposition (January 30-February 1, 2024, Orlando, USA)","about":"Space Congress is the premier, global commercial space event that attracts thousands of space professionals with its dynamic show floor, late-breaking critical industry outlooks, an engaging conference program, powerful networking and special events","text":"As part of Commercial Space Week, SpaceCom | 50th Space Congress brings together the entire space ecosystem including sub and prime contractors from commercial industry, international agencies and organizations, end-use markets, major government branches such as NASA, the DoD, the US Space Force and Space Systems Commend, spaceports, and more.\r\nThis is the central resource for accelerating the construction of our space infrastructure and capabilities to: Ensure Defense Capabilities, Create an Intelligence-Driven Presence in Space, Connect End-Users with Competitive Capabilities, Create an Agile Launch & On-Orbit Servicing Program,Establish a Global Spaceport Network, Empower Exploration & Scientific Research, Create Sustainable Solutions for the Planet, Protect and Increase the Quality of Life for Humankind.\r\nThe event is organized by National Trade Productions","link_original":"https://www.spacecomexpo.com/","status":2,"country":[{"id":240,"name":"United States of America","icon":""}],"sections":[{"id":36,"name":"Contamination of near-Earth space"}],"root_section":{"id":107,"name":"Life-friendly Earth"},"is_photo":false,"is_video":false,"is_large_font":false,"show_in_news_list":false,"url_to_show_in_news_list":"","location_filters":{"countries":[{"id":240,"name":"United States of America"}],"regions":[{"id":4,"name":"North America"}]},"filters":[{"id":22,"name":"Events","badge_name":"Event","show_badge":false,"children":[],"all_children":true,"all_children_ids":""}]},{"id":"f88c0adc-89c6-4f00-b35c-36a48cf77146","slug":"what-is-sustainable-fishing-post","created_at":"2024-12-04T11:35:11.688635Z","views":12,"name":"What is sustainable fishing?","about":"Fishing is sustainable if it leaves enough fish in the oceans and minimises impacts on habitats and ecosystems. It is crucial for securing food, supporting livelihoods, and addressing global hunger and poverty. Overfishing and harmful practices threaten ocean ecosystems, with over one-third of global fisheries exceeding sustainable limits. Sustainable fisheries can produce 16 million more tonnes of seafood annually, reducing reliance on land-based protein sources and offering a lower carbon footprint.\nKey measures for sustainable fishing include monitoring fish stocks, adopting precautionary harvest control rules, and implementing management practices such as size limits, seasonal restrictions, and gear modifications to reduce bycatch and habitat destruction. Sustainable methods preserve biodiversity, protect endangered species, and contribute to climate regulation by maintaining ocean health.","link_original":"https://www.msc.org/what-we-are-doing/our-approach/what-is-sustainable-fishing","status":2,"country":[],"sections":[{"id":175,"name":"Hunting and fishing"}],"root_section":{"id":108,"name":"Conserving Wild Nature"},"is_photo":true,"is_video":false,"is_large_font":false,"show_in_news_list":false,"url_to_show_in_news_list":"","location_filters":{"countries":[],"regions":[]},"filters":[]},{"id":"f8910507-fcae-4760-855a-deb92be31896","slug":"innovative-solutions-for-managing-the-billing-experience-in-the-utility-sector-14-september-2023-post","created_at":"2023-11-23T11:18:31.586082Z","views":33,"name":"Innovative solutions for managing the billing experience in the Utility sector (14 September, 2023)","about":"The Doxee article by Elisabetta Severoni explores innovative solutions for managing the billing experience in the utility sector, emphasizing the importance of electronic invoicing.","text":"In the Utilities sector, billing complexity has led to innovations for efficiency, with cloud-based SaaS platforms at the forefront.
